2. Naming and Organizing Layers
One of the best ways to manage layers efficiently is by giving them descriptive names that indicate their purpose. By double-clicking on a layer’s name in the Layers panel and entering a new name, you can rename that layer. Additionally, you can make a layer group by selecting a set of related layers, then hitting the Ctrl/Cmd+G keyboard shortcut. You can then name the layer group to keep your layers organized.
3. Using Layer Masks
With the aid of layer masks, you can disclose or conceal a layer’s components without completely erasing them. You can apply a layer mask to a layer by tapping on the “Add Layer Mask” option at the bottom of the Layers panel. Then, you can color on the layer mask with a brush tool to conceal or expose specific portions of the layer. This is especially helpful when you want to make non-destructive changes to an image.
4. Creating Adjustment Layers
Adjustment Layers are a powerful utility that enables you to make adjustments to your picture without altering the initial pixels. By selecting the “Create new fill or adjustment layer” button at the base of the Layers panel, you can create an adjustment layer. The type of adjustment you want to use, such as brightness, contrast, or color balance, is then your choice.
5. Working with Smart Objects
Smart Objects, which are layers that hold one or more other layers, let you change a picture in a non-destructive way. By selecting “Convert to Smart Object” from the context menu when you right-click on a layer, you can turn it into a Smart Object. After that, you can make adjustments like scaling or rotation without completely changing the initial pixels.
